SPY
Looking back you can see the clearly defined up channel from the open hitting resistance at R1 (not shown on chart) and quickly dropping through previous' day high (134.4'ish) and bouncing above 134 & the daily pivot (not shown on chart)





SPWRA
I got chopped up in this solar name as my expectations of a possible uptrend were wrong. Steve Spencer @smbcapital or @sspence_smb highlighted that the real move in solars took place prior to earnings so that should have sent up a red flag trying to catch a BIG upmove. I probably should have waited and watched the open as the high was quickly faded and then found support around 18.5 but that broke and the stock ultimately ended around 18. Eliminating 8 stabs (7 for losses & 1 for a tiny gain) and I would have had a nice positive Friday. Lesson learned, new charting setup implemented, notes entered into journal, move on. 




ARUN
Another choppy trade for me as I anticipated a possible trend ride that never really materialized. The stock found a range 31.50-30.5 and just moved sideways all day. Probably would have had a decent day if I had recognized this. At the end of the day managed to finish positive on this trade.

SPY

What you'll notice here is that we gapped up made a run into 134 resistance and came down to yesterday's high and traded in an up channel for the remainder of the day. The market topped out at 11AM and as a result many stocks followed suit.



JDSU

HT @smbcapital for this morning idea. When I noticed that JDSU was holding above 35c. Think I got involved around 45c and caught the entire opening drive and read this one to a tee selling all the way to the top. Tried again later in the afternoon to catch a second move when it broke VWAP but unfortunately just churned and lost 10¢ 


SF

Caught multiple +50c scalps in this when it first broke the pennant then when it held 72.50 selling at 73 & then when it broke 73.3 caught it for another +50c


ANF

Only caught a +50c move in this name on one of the dips around noon. I should have set an alert for when it broke above the morning's high around 2PM.


CMCSA

I tried 1 trade in CMCSA but got stopped out -10c when it dropped suddenly (market drop) below the consolidation base. I could have gone long when it broke the down channel & VWAP and/or when it broke the morning's high. Oh well not a clean "In Play" move
